hi,how did u render the PRT loader in static mode while the camera moves around it?im having problem doing that as when i animate my camera,the PRT loader animates too.i tried collapsing the PRT loader,but i lost the colours made in krakatoa channel.hope i can get an answer from you thanks.
critleaks 2 months ago
@critleaks PRT Loader -> Particle File Loader rolldown menu -> timing section -> check the "Limit to Custom Range" and then type in the frame you want to freeze, e.g.: "Range 100 - 100", so now, your PRT loader will only read the 100th frame, but keep all the colour and velocity, etc parameters. hope I helped :)
csicso3d 2 months ago 2
@critleaks Another method is to check the "Graph [a]" (leave it to 0), and to the frame offset just type in the frame number you want to hold. Good luck :)
